在webpack中,可以通过配置module.rules来指定将资源加载到哪种类型的父文件的哪种类型的加载器。module.rules是一个数组,每个元素代表一个加载规则。
加载规则由两部分组成:test和use。test用于匹配需要加载的文件类型,可以是正则表达式或者文件路径。use指定了加载器的类型。
例如,如果要将.js文件加载到babel-loader进行转译,可以这样配置:
module: {
rules: [
{
test: /\.js$/,
use: 'babel-loader'
}
]
}
这样,当webpack遇到以.js结尾的文件时,就会使用babel-loader进行加载和转译。
在这个例子中,加载器的类型是babel-loader,它可以将ES6+的代码转译为ES5的代码,以便在旧版本的浏览器中运行。babel-loader是一个常用的前端加载器,适用于前端开发中的模块化、语法转换等场景。
推荐的腾讯云相关产品和产品介绍链接地址:
以上是腾讯云提供的一些相关产品,可以根据具体需求选择适合的产品进行开发和部署。
领取专属 10元无门槛券
手把手带您无忧上云